Hola, soy Andrea Crawford con IBM Cloud y vamos a hablar de la migración a la nube. Echemos un vistazo a esta imagen. Aquí tenemos la infraestructura empresarial, donde generalmente se encuentran muchas de nuestras cargas de trabajo de cómputo, como sistemas base de metal, sistemas principales de la empresa, centros de datos locales y nubes privadas, también en las instalaciones pero con capacidades en la nube. Luego tenemos la nube pública, que son capacidades en la nube fuera de las instalaciones.
Muchas de nuestras empresas aún tienen dificultades para trasladar las cargas de trabajo de la infraestructura empresarial a la nube. Por lo tanto, cuando migramos esas cargas de trabajo empresariales a la nube privada o pública, lo llamamos migración. Todo esto se trata de comprender las cargas de trabajo empresariales y sus características, para determinar si deberían estar en la nube local o en la nube pública fuera de las instalaciones.
Índice
Modernización y construcción nativa
También tenemos la opción de modernizar. Algunas de las cargas de trabajo podrían ser refactorizadas, por ejemplo, si tenemos código monolítico en una plataforma principal, podríamos agregar API para exponer funciones de negocio principales y así modernizar esas funciones para que puedan residir en la nube local. Además, tenemos el caso de construir aplicaciones nativas para aquellas cargas de trabajo que pertenecen a la nube pública. Si tenemos la oportunidad de diseñar aplicaciones nativas en la nube para que funcionen aquí o allá, podríamos aprovechar ventajas como el seguimiento de microservicios y el enrutamiento de tráfico utilizando identificadores de correlación. También podríamos aprovechar funciones de equilibrio de carga y gestión de servicios en las nubes, que nos ofrecen capacidades fundamentales dentro de la plataforma, liberándonos de la logística y la capa de aplicación para ser más innovadores.
Beneficios de la migración a la nube
Esto nos lleva a los beneficios de mover, migrar y modernizar aplicaciones en la nube. En primer lugar, es rentable, ya que podemos reducir nuestros costos, especialmente los relacionados con la infraestructura local y dejar que los proveedores de la nube se encarguen de la gestión de esas cargas de trabajo. Además, obtenemos escalabilidad gracias a la virtualización y las capacidades de Cloud Foundry y Kubernetes. Podemos aprovechar los servicios básicos de estos modelos, pero también tenemos la flexibilidad de usar servidores físicos o máquinas virtuales según nuestras necesidades. Uno de los grandes beneficios es la seguridad. Gracias a la nube, podemos olvidarnos de muchos de los servicios fundamentales que habríamos tenido que preocuparnos en la infraestructura local. Actualmente, muchos de los proveedores de nube abordan las preocupaciones de seguridad, cumplimiento y protección de datos, ofreciendo servicios que cumplen con estas regulaciones. Por último, tenemos una mayor adopción acelerada gracias a las capacidades de enrutamiento, descubrimiento de servicios y equilibrio de carga proporcionados por la nube, lo cual nos permite no preocuparnos por esto en el nivel de la aplicación.
Resumen de la migración a la nube
Migración | Modernización | Construcción Nativa |
---|---|---|
Cargas de trabajo de infraestructura empresarial migradas a nubes local o pública. | Refactorización de cargas de trabajo para su modernización. | Desarrollo de aplicaciones nativas para nubes locales o públicas. |
Preguntas frecuentes
A continuación, responderemos algunas preguntas comunes sobre la migración a la nube:
1. ¿Cuál es la diferencia entre la nube local y la nube pública?
La nube local se ejecuta en las instalaciones de una empresa, mientras que la nube pública es proporcionada por proveedores externos y se encuentra fuera de las instalaciones.
2. ¿Qué significa «refactorizar» una carga de trabajo?
Refactorizar una carga de trabajo implica modificar o reestructurar su código para mejorar su eficiencia o integración con otras tecnologías.
3. ¿Cuáles son los beneficios de la migración a la nube?
Los beneficios de la migración a la nube incluyen una reducción de costos, escalabilidad, mayor seguridad y una mayor capacidad para adoptar nuevas tecnologías.
Esperamos que esta información te haya sido útil. No dudes en consultar nuestros artículos relacionados para obtener más detalles sobre la migración a la nube.
¡Gracias por leer este artículo y si tienes alguna pregunta o comentario, déjanos tus inquietudes a continuación!
¿Te ha resultado útil??
0 / 0
Hola, somos Mila Jiménez y César Sánchez. Dos apasionados de la ciberseguridad con muchos años de experiencia. Hemos trabajado en muchas empresas del mundo TI y ahora nos apetece compartir nuestro conocimiento con cualquiera que lo necesite.
¡Si te gusta nuestro contenido puedes invitarnos a un café AQUÍ!